免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

php公众号开发框架

PHP是一门广泛应用于Web开发的编程语言,而公众号开发则是近年来越来越受到关注的领域。为了更好地支持公众号开发,一些PHP框架也相应地进行了升级和优化。在本文中,我们将介绍一些常用的PHP公众号开发框架,以及它们的原理和使用方法。

1. 微擎

微擎是一款开源的公众号开发框架,它是以Yii框架为基础开发而来的,因此具有Yii框架的优点,如高效、稳定、安全等。微擎提供了一系列公众号开发所需的基础功能,如微信认证、自定义菜单、消息回复等,同时也支持插件机制,可以方便地扩展自己的功能。微擎还提供了完善的后台管理系统,方便用户进行管理和维护。

2. EasyWeChat

EasyWeChat是一个基于PHP的微信公众号开发框架,它提供了一系列易于使用的API,可以方便地实现公众号开发所需的各种功能。EasyWeChat支持自定义菜单、消息回复、素材管理、用户管理等功能,同时也支持多账号管理、事件监听等高级功能。EasyWeChat还提供了完备的文档和示例代码,方便用户快速入门和开发。

3. ThinkPHP

ThinkPHP是一款国内比较流行的PHP框架,它也提供了一些公众号开发所需的基础功能,如微信认证、自定义菜单、消息回复等。ThinkPHP还支持插件机制,可以方便地扩展自己的功能。与其他框架相比,ThinkPHP的文档和社区支持非常完善,用户可以轻松地找到解决问题的方法。

4. Laravel

Laravel是一款流行的PHP框架,它也可以用来进行公众号开发。Laravel提供了一些基础功能,如路由、控制器、模型等,同时也支持Composer依赖管理和Artisan命令行工具。Laravel的文档和社区支持也非常好,用户可以轻松地找到所需的帮助和资源。

5. CodeIgniter

CodeIgniter是一款轻量级的PHP框架,它可以用于快速开发Web应用程序和公众号应用程序。CodeIgniter提供了一些基础功能,如路由、控制器、模型等,同时也支持Composer依赖管理和命令行工具。CodeIgniter的文档相对较少,但社区支持也比较活跃,用户可以在社区中寻找所需的帮助和资源。

总结:

以上是一些常用的PHP公众号开发框架,它们都提供了一些基础功能和高级功能,用户可以根据自己的需求选择适合自己的框架。需要注意的是,框架只是工具,真正的开发还需要理解微信公众号的开发原理和规范,才能更好地开发出高质量的公众号应用程序。


相关知识:
苹果app封装
苹果App封装是将iOS应用程序打包成IPA格式,以便在App Store或企业应用商店中发布和分发的过程。它是将应用程序打包成一个可安装文件的过程,以便用户可以轻松地下载和使用应用程序。在这个过程中,应用程序被编译、签名和打包成一个单独的文件,以便可以在
2023-04-06
自己做app
随着移动互联网的快速发展,越来越多的人开始尝试自己做APP。那么,自己做APP的原理是什么呢?下面,我将为大家详细介绍一下。首先,自己做APP需要掌握一些基础知识,比如编程语言、开发工具等等。其中,常用的编程语言包括Java、Objective-C、Swi
2023-04-06
开发app的框架
移动应用程序框架是一种软件框架,可以帮助开发人员快速构建移动应用程序。这些框架提供了一组工具、库和API,使开发人员能够更加轻松地创建和部署移动应用程序。以下是几种常见的移动应用程序框架:1. React NativeReact Native是一个由Fac
2023-04-06
html转换apk
HTML转换APK是将HTML5网页应用程序转换为Android应用程序的过程。本文将介绍HTML转换APK的原理和详细介绍。一、原理HTML转换APK的原理是将HTML5网页应用程序通过一个工具转换为Android应用程序。这个工具会将HTML5网页应用
2023-04-06
h5转ios app
H5是指基于HTML5技术开发的网页,而iOS App是运行在苹果iOS操作系统上的应用程序。将H5转换为iOS App可以使得网页变成一个独立的应用程序,用户可以在不依赖于浏览器的情况下使用它。H5转iOS App的实现方式有两种:Native App、
2023-04-06
sdk包匹配
SDK(Software Development Kit)是软件开发过程中的一种集成开发环境,包含了软件开发所需的各种工具和组件,可以帮助开发者快速构建应用程序。在开发过程中,SDK包的匹配十分重要,下面将详细介绍SDK包匹配的原理。一、SDK包的概念SD
2023-04-06
基于vue的app
Vue是一种流行的JavaScript框架,它被广泛用于构建Web应用程序。Vue可以轻松创建交互式用户界面,并提供了许多强大的功能,例如数据绑定、组件化和路由管理等。在本文中,我们将介绍如何使用Vue构建一个基于Vue的应用程序。1. 安装Vue要使用V
2023-04-06
app开发个人体会
作为一名从事移动应用开发多年的开发者,我认为,App开发的过程可以分为以下几个步骤:1.需求分析在开发一款App之前,首先需要明确这款App的目标用户、功能、界面设计等方面的需求。只有深入了解用户的需求,才能开发出受用户欢迎的App。2.技术选型根据需求分
2023-04-06
html5移动端开发
HTML5 移动端开发是一种基于 HTML5 技术的移动端应用开发方式。它通过使用 HTML5、CSS3 和 JavaScript 来构建移动应用程序,以实现跨平台的应用程序开发。HTML5 移动端开发已经成为现代移动应用开发的主要方式之一,因为它可以帮助
2023-04-06
分众楼宇框架板app
分众楼宇框架板app是一款基于大数据和智能化技术的智慧楼宇应用,主要用于管理和监控商业楼宇的信息化建设。该应用的主要功能包括:楼宇管理、租户管理、设备管理、能耗管理、安全管理等等。下面我将从技术原理和应用场景两个方面来详细介绍这款应用。一、技术原理1.大数
2023-04-06
移动的端开发
移动端开发已经成为了互联网行业中不可或缺的一部分,随着智能手机的普及,越来越多的人们开始使用手机进行上网、购物、社交等活动,这也促进了移动端开发的发展。本文将从移动端开发的原理和详细介绍两个方面进行讲解。一、移动端开发原理1. 响应式设计响应式设计是指网站
2023-04-06
android 设备开发框架
Android 设备开发框架是一种基于 Java 的开源框架,用于构建 Android 应用程序。它提供了一系列的 API 和工具,使开发人员能够轻松地创建高质量的应用程序。以下是 Android 设备开发框架的详细介绍。1. 应用程序框架应用程序框架是
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号